
.shea_prod_hedr {
width: 591px;
height: 29px;
margin-top:20px;
}
.shea_prod_hedr H1 {
width: 591px;
height: 29px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_prod_hedr H1 span {
background:url(/images/brands/landing_page/prod_hedr.gif) no-repeat;
position:absolute;
width: 591px;
height: 29px;
display:block;
text-indent: -9999px;
}




.shea_right_npf_hed {
width: 322px;
height: 32px;
}
.shea_right_npf_hed H2 {
width: 322px;
height: 32px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_right_npf_hed H2 span {
background:url(/images/brands/brand_info/right_npf_hed.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}



.shea_right_sl_hed {
width: 322px;
height: 32px;
}
.shea_right_sl_hed H2 {
width: 322px;
height: 32px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_right_sl_hed H2 span {
background:url(/images/brands/brand_info/right_sl_hed.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}




.shea_wtb_hedr {
width: 591px;
height: 29px;
margin-top:18px; 
padding-bottom:10px;
}
.shea_wtb_hedr H1 {
width: 591px;
height: 29px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_wtb_hedr H1 span {
background:url(/images/consumer/storelocator/wtb_hedr.gif) no-repeat;
position:absolute;
width: 591px;
height: 29px;
display:block;
text-indent: -9999px;
}




.shea_just_for_you {
width: 322px;
height: 32px;
}
.shea_just_for_you H2 {
width: 322px;
height: 32px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_just_for_you H2 span {
background:url(/images/consumer/common/justforyou/just_for_you.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}


.shea_promos_offers {
width: 322px;
height: 32px;
}
.shea_promos_offers H2 {
width: 322px;
height: 32px;
overflow:hidden; 
color:#E72831;
margin:0; 
padding:0; 
}
.shea_promos_offers H2 span {
background:url(/images/consumer/storelocator/promos_offers.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}



.shea_recipe_microwave {
width: 262px;
height: 59px;
margin-left:15px;
}
.shea_recipe_microwave H3 {
width: 262px;
height: 59px;
overflow:hidden; 
margin:0; 
padding:0; 
}
.shea_recipe_microwave H3 span {
background:url(/images/consumer/recipe_microwave.gif) no-repeat;
position:absolute;
width: 262px;
height: 59px;
display:block;
text-indent: -9999px;
cursor:pointer;
}




.shea_just_for_you {
width: 322px;
height: 32px;
}
.shea_just_for_you H3 {
width: 322px;
height: 32px;
overflow:hidden; 
margin:0; 
padding:0; 
}
.shea_just_for_you H3 span {
background:url(/images/consumer/common/justforyou/just_for_you.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}



.shea_right_npf_hed {
width: 322px;
height: 32px;
}
.shea_right_npf_hed H3 {
width: 322px;
height: 32px;
overflow:hidden; 
margin:0; 
padding:0; 
}
.shea_right_npf_hed H3 span {
background:url(/images/brands/brand_info/right_npf_hed.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}



.shea_right_sl_hed {
width: 322px;
height: 32px;
}
.shea_right_sl_hed H3 {
width: 322px;
height: 32px;
overflow:hidden; 
margin:0; 
padding:0; 
}
.shea_right_sl_hed H3 span {
background:url(/images/brands/brand_info/right_sl_hed.gif) no-repeat;
position:absolute;
width: 322px;
height: 32px;
display:block;
text-indent: -9999px;
}

div#cpn-ctrl-rt {
	background-image:url('/images/consumer/coupons.gif');
	height:85px;
	background-repeat:no-repeat;
}

div#cpn-ctrl-rt h3{
	text-indent:-9999px;
	margin:0;
	padding:0;
}

div#cpn-ctrl-rt p{
	width:330px;
	margin-left:18px;
	margin-top:17px;
	margin-bottom:0;
	padding:0;
}

div#cpn-ctrl-rt a{
	display:block;
	width:100%;
	text-indent:-9999px;
	height:20px;;
}
